آموزش صفت Novalidate در HTML
سلام خدمت تمامی دوستان و همراهان محترم سایت آموزشی فری لرن ، امیدوارم که حال همگیتون خوب باشه. لطفا در ادامه با آموزش صفت Novalidate در HTML با من همراه باشید.
Free-Learn
آنچه در این جلسه میخوانید :
صفت Novalidate در HTML
صفت novalidate
صفتی است که میتوان از آن در تگ Form استفاده کرد و تعریف کرد که داده های عناصر / فیلدهای فرم در هنگام ارسال به سرور اعتبارسنجی نشوند.
همونطور که میدونید در بعضی از فرم ها یکسری از فیلدها وجود دارند که حتما باید تکمیل شوند, مثلا فیلد ایمیل میگه باید حتما یک آدرس ایمیل معتبر وارد شود – حال اگر از این صفت در تگ فرم استفاده نماییم دیگه میتونیم بدون اینکه فیلدها اعتبار سنجی شوند داده ها ارسال شوند.
Free-Learn
عناصری که توسط این صفت پشتیبانی می شوند
این صفت را میتوان در عناصر/تگ های زیر بکار برد.
<form> |
Free-Learn
مثال از صفت Novalidate در HTML
در ادامه میتوانید یک مثال از این صفت را مشاهده نمایید.
1 2 3 4 5 6 7 8 9 |
<body> <form action="files/test.php" novalidate> نام : <input type="text" name="fname"> <br> ایمیل : <input type="email" name="email"> <br> <input type="submit" value="ارسال"> </form> </body> |
Free-Learn
پشتیبانی مرورگرها
در جدول زیر میتوانید مشاهده نمایید که آیا مرورگرهای اینترنتی از صفت novalidate
در HTML پشتیبانی میکنند یا خیر.
نام صفت | Chrome | Firefox | Opera | Safari | IE |
novalidate | ۱۰٫۰ | ۴٫۰ | ۱۰٫۶ | خیر | ۱۰٫۰ |
Free-Learn
نکات و توضیحات
صفت novalidate
یک صفت جدید/اضافه شده در HTML5 می باشد.
نحوه استفاده از این صفت در XHTML بصورت زیر می باشد :
1 |
<form novalidate="novalidate"> |